EP20K600CB652C7N Overview
An FPGA (Field-Programmable Gate Array) is a semiconductor integrated circuit whose logic fabric and routing can be configured by the customer after manufacture, enabling hardware re-programmability for prototyping, design iteration, and low-to-medium volume production. FPGAs sit within the broader hierarchy of programmable logic devices (PLDs), which also includes CPLDs and SPLDs. The APEX 20KC family extends the APEX 20K architecture, and APEX itself belongs to the larger class of complex programmable logic devices (CPLDs) used in lieu of fixed-function ASICs when time-to-market and design flexibility outweigh per-unit silicon cost.
Key features of the EP20K600CB652C7N include 24,320 logic elements (LEs), 311,296 embedded memory bits, 488 maximum user I/Os, an internal operating frequency up to 375.94 MHz, and 0.15 um all-layer copper-metal fabrication. The 1.8 V core supply is paired with multi-voltage I/O standards supported by the APEX 20K I/O structure. The device also integrates PLLs for clock management and supports in-system configuration via passive serial, passive parallel, and JTAG modes.
The architecture combines LUT-based logic elements with embedded memory blocks (Embedded System Blocks, ESBs) on a MultiCore interconnect. The 0.15 um copper process yields roughly 35 percent faster design performance than the prior APEX 20KE generation, while the MultiCore fabric improves utilization for wide datapath designs. Eight PLLs are distributed across the device to support skew-managed clock trees.
Typical applications include high-speed telecom line cards, ASIC prototyping and emulation, broadband aggregation, industrial control, test and measurement backplanes, and digital signal processing glue logic where gate counts exceed what a CPLD can absorb.
Design considerations include careful thermal management under sustained switching activity, multi-voltage I/O bank planning for mixed logic domains, and supply decoupling at every core pin pair because the 1.8 V rail is sensitive to IR drop during simultaneous switching.

View Datasheet →EP20K600CB652C7N Maximum Ratings & Electrical Characteristics
| Family | APEX 20KC |
| Device Type | SPLD / Loadable PLD (FPGA) |
| System Gates | 600,000 |
| Logic Elements | 24,320 |
| Embedded Memory (bits) | 311,296 |
| Maximum User I/Os | 488 |
| Propagation Delay | 1.48 ns |
| Internal Operating Frequency | 375.94 MHz |
| Process Technology | 0.15 um all-layer copper-metal |
| Core Supply Voltage | 1.8 V |
| Package | 652-ball BGA (PBGA-652, S-PBGA-B652) |
| Package Dimensions | 45 x 45 mm |
| Ball Pitch | 1.27 mm |
| Operating Temperature | 0 C to 85 C |

High-Speed Telecom Line Card Glue Logic
The EP20K600CB652C7N fits telecom line-card glue logic because it delivers 600K system gates, 24,320 logic elements, and 311 Kbits of embedded SRAM in a single device. The 1.48 ns propagation delay in the C7 speed grade enables fabric crossings at multi-hundred-megahertz rates, while 488 user I/Os accommodate wide datapath buses, UTOPIA / POS-PHY interfaces, and multiple S/PDIF or Ethernet ports. Compared with a CPLD, the APEX 20KC supports deeper state machines and on-chip FIFOs without resorting to external SRAM. Compared with an ASIC, it shortens NPI cycles for protocol revisions such as SONET/SDH framing, ATM SAR segmentation, or 10G backplane aggregation. Designers should still validate I/O bank voltages per port because mixing 3.3 V LVTTL with 2.5 V LVCMOS on the same die requires careful bank planning.

ASIC Prototyping and Emulation
The EP20K600CB652C7N is well-suited to ASIC prototyping because 600K gates can absorb a moderate-complexity ASIC netlist at 1:1 mapping. The 311 Kbits of embedded memory allow distributed register banks and small FIFO emulation, and 488 I/Os let the FPGA mimic a wide external ASIC pin-out. Quartus II and MAX+PLUS II both support APEX 20KC, and the JTAG configuration mode is compatible with standard emulators such as the ByteBlaster. Designers should map ASIC clock trees to the device's PLLs and budget hold time carefully because routing delays differ between FPGA and ASIC back-end flows. For multi-ASIC prototyping, designers can ganged multiple EP20K600 parts over LVDS interconnects because the I/O structure supports LVDS at up to 840 Mbps.

Design Notes
The APEX 20KC core runs at 1.8 V and is sensitive to rail noise. Estimated: at 50 percent toggle rate and 75 percent utilization, ICC_core can reach 2.5 A (about 4.5 W). Use a low-noise LDO such as a TPS7A4701 followed by a 22 uF input bulk and 10 x 10 uF ceramic decoupling caps distributed around the BGA periphery. Keep the 1.8 V plane at least 2 oz copper to limit IR drop on simultaneous-switching events.
The 45 x 45 mm BGA-652 has a theta_JA in the 8 to 12 C/W range with adequate copper pour. Estimated: at 5 W dissipation, junction rises 40 to 60 C above ambient; for a 70 C ambient application the C7N commercial part (rated 85 C) is acceptable, but extended-temperature variants must be used above 70 C ambient. Place thermals vias under the central die-flag balls to spread heat into inner copper planes.
BGA-652 with 1.27 mm pitch requires 0.6 mm pads with NSMD (non-solder mask defined) geometry for reliable assembly. Use a 4+ mil via-in-pad with copper-filled and capped plating for signal balls under the die. Maintain 50 ohm controlled impedance for LVDS pairs and 60 ohm for LVDS bus topologies. Escape routing on the top layer should fan out on a 1.0 mm grid to allow fan-out between balls.
Mixing 5 V tolerant and 3.3 V banks without proper VREF decoupling is the most common failure. The APEX 20KC I/O structure supports 1.8/2.5/3.3 V standards but does NOT tolerate 5 V input on non-5V-tolerant banks - verify each bank voltage in the Quartus pin planner. Also, do not load configuration data from a 3.3 V EEPROM without a level shifter; the configuration pins expect 1.8 V logic levels during multi-device configuration chains.
Synchronous output switching on 488 I/Os can cause SSO-induced ground bounce of 0.3 to 0.5 V. Spread switching outputs across multiple I/O banks, use slew-rate control bits set to 'slow' on non-timing-critical nets, and add 33 ohm series damping resistors on long traces (>50 mm) to the backplane. Ground-bounce measurement should be performed with the device in its actual socket to capture package lead inductance.
